Objective

Knowledge and understanding of and proficiency in:
- the basic principles and basic components of electricity generation, transmission and distribution, as well as the utilization of electric energy
- structure, components and characteristics of the electric distribution network

Content

- structure of electricity production and consumption
- principles and basic components of electrical networks
- basic features of transformers and most common electric machines, basic structure and components of electric motor operation
- operating principles of the electricity market
